Output 83fa8b16f2a76b799dfc9e6e2bcb1866c2aeb4dc60c32cf3dcdd8d7d69fc4ba3:0

value
187142
script pubkey
OP_0 OP_PUSHBYTES_20 c5103a208c21bcba52a7783bfb8265e6ad27068d
address
bc1qc5gr5gyvyx7t55480qalhqn9u6kjwp5dmu79s7
transaction
83fa8b16f2a76b799dfc9e6e2bcb1866c2aeb4dc60c32cf3dcdd8d7d69fc4ba3
confirmations
1407
spent
true